Logical Drive Status.
The logical drive can be in one of the following states:
Ok (2)
Indicates that the logical drive is in normal operation mode.
Failed (3)
Indicates that more physical drives have failed than the
fault tolerance mode of the logical drive can handle without
data loss.
Unconfigured (4)
Indicates that the logical drive is not configured.
Recovering (5)
Indicates that the logical drive is using Interim Recovery Mode.
In Interim Recovery Mode, at least one physical drive has
failed, but the logical drive`s fault tolerance mode lets the
drive continue to operate with no data loss.
Ready Rebuild (6)
Indicates that the logical drive is ready for Automatic Data
Recovery. The physical drive that failed has been replaced,
but the logical drive is still operating in Interim Recovery
Mode.
Rebuilding (7)
Indicates that the logical drive is currently doing Automatic
Data Recovery. During Automatic Data Recovery, fault tolerance
algorithms restore data to the replacement drive.
Wrong Drive (8)
Indicates that the wrong physical drive was replaced after a
physical drive failure.
Bad Connect (9)
Indicates that a physical drive is not responding.
Overheating (10)
Indicates that the storage box that contains the logical drive
is overheating. The array is still functioning, but
should be shutdown.
Shutdown (11)
Indicates that the storage box that contains the logical drive
has overheated. The logical drive is no longer functioning.
Expanding (12)
Indicates that the logical drive is currently doing Automatic
Data Expansion. During Automatic Data Expansion, fault
tolerance algorithms redistribute logical drive data to the
newly added physical drive.
Not Available (13)
Indicates that the logical drive is currently unavailable.
If a logical drive is expanding and the new configuration
frees additional disk space, this free space can be
configured into another logical volume. If this is done,
the new volume will be set to not available.
Queued For Expansion (14)
Indicates that the logical drive is ready for Automatic Data
Expansion. The logical drive is in the queue for expansion.
Hard Error (15)
Indicates that a hard error occurred for this LUN.
